/* Establish the initial context for the current lookahead if no initial
|
|
context is currently established.
|
|
|
|
We define a context as a snapshot of the parser stacks. We define
|
|
the initial context for a lookahead as the context in which the
|
|
parser initially examines that lookahead in order to select a
|
|
syntactic action. Thus, if the lookahead eventually proves
|
|
syntactically unacceptable (possibly in a later context reached via a
|
|
series of reductions), the initial context can be used to determine
|
|
the exact set of tokens that would be syntactically acceptable in the
|
|
lookahead's place. Moreover, it is the context after which any
|
|
further semantic actions would be erroneous because they would be
|
|
determined by a syntactically unacceptable token.
|
|
|
|
YY_LAC_ESTABLISH should be invoked when a reduction is about to be
|
|
performed in an inconsistent state (which, for the purposes of LAC,
|
|
includes consistent states that don't know they're consistent because
|
|
their default reductions have been disabled). Iff there is a
|
|
lookahead token, it should also be invoked before reporting a syntax
|
|
error. This latter case is for the sake of the debugging output.
|
|
|
|
For parse.lac=full, the implementation of YY_LAC_ESTABLISH is as
|
|
follows. If no initial context is currently established for the
|
|
current lookahead, then check if that lookahead can eventually be
|
|
shifted if syntactic actions continue from the current context.
|
|
Report a syntax error if it cannot. */

/* There are many possibilities here to consider:
|
|
- If this state is a consistent state with a default action, then
|
|
the only way this function was invoked is if the default action
|
|
is an error action. In that case, don't check for expected
|
|
tokens because there are none.
|
|
- The only way there can be no lookahead present (in yychar) is if
|
|
this state is a consistent state with a default action. Thus,
|
|
detecting the absence of a lookahead is sufficient to determine
|
|
that there is no unexpected or expected token to report. In that
|
|
case, just report a simple "syntax error".
|
|
- Don't assume there isn't a lookahead just because this state is a
|
|
consistent state with a default action. There might have been a
|
|
previous inconsistent state, consistent state with a non-default
|
|
action, or user semantic action that manipulated yychar.
|
|
In the first two cases, it might appear that the current syntax
|
|
error should have been detected in the previous state when yy_lac
|
|
was invoked. However, at that time, there might have been a
|
|
different syntax error that discarded a different initial context
|
|
during error recovery, leaving behind the current lookahead.
|
|
*/
